What is the cheapest month to fly from Calgary to Missouri?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for round-trip flights from Calgary to Missouri,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.

The cheapest month for flights from Calgary to Missouri is February, when tickets cost $413 (return) on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are November and January, when the average cost of round-trip tickets is $567 and $528 respectively.

  • What is the Hacker Fare option on flights from Calgary to Missouri?

    Hacker Fares allow you to combine one-way tickets in order to save you money over a traditional round-trip ticket. You could then fly from Calgary to Missouri with an airline and back with another airline.

  • What is KAYAK's "flexible dates" feature and why should I care when looking for a flight from Calgary to Missouri?

    Sometimes travel dates aren't set in stone. If your preferred travel dates have some wiggle room, flexible dates will show you all the options when flying from Calgary to Missouri up to 3 days before/after your preferred dates. You can then pick the flights that suit you best.
